Fire Island (Japanese: 火の島 Fire Island) is an island in the central Orange Archipelago, featured in the second movie.

The Fire Island shrine

Fire Island is the southeastern one of the three elemental islands, and is the home of the Legendary Moltres. The island has a small volcano in the center of the island as well as a forest on one side of the island and rocky shorelines on the other.

Ash visited Fire Island first in his quest to fulfill the Legend Festival's Chosen One myth. He soon obtained the Fire Treasure, a glowing orb located in a small altar that overlooks a volcanic crater.

Lawrence III had already captured Moltres prior, but returned to Fire Island to capture Zapdos, which moved to Fire Island soon after to claim the area that Moltres had seemingly abandoned. Inadvertently, he also captured Ash, Misty, Tracey, Pikachu, Melody, and Team Rocket, whose boat was of similar size to the legendary birds, and brought them aboard his airship.

After Ash placed all three of island treasures at the Shamouti Island shrine, peace was restored and Moltres returned to Fire Island.
